How many moles of sulfate ions (SO42−) are present in 1.5 mol of Al2(SO4)3?

Answers

Answer 1
Answer:

Answer:4.5 moles of sulfate ions are present in 1.5 moles of Al_2(SO_4)_3.

Explanation:

Al_2(SO_4)_3\rightarrow 2Al^(3+)+3SO_(4)^(2-)

1 mol of Al_2(SO_4)_3 gives 3 moles of sulfate ions.

Moles of sulfate ion in 1.5 moles : 1.5* 3=4.5 moles

4.5 moles of sulfate ions are present in 1.5 moles of Al_2(SO_4)_3.

A fruit and oatmeal bar contains 142 nutritional calories. Convert this energy to calories

Answers

Answer is: a fruit and oatmeal bar contains 142000 calories.
A nutritional calorie, or kilocalorie, is equal to 1000 calories.
E = 142 kcal · 1000 cal/kcal.
E = 142 000 cal.
Calorie (cal), or small calorie, is the amount of energy needed to heat one gram of water by one degree Celsius.
One small calorie is approximately 4.2 joules.
A calorie is a unit of energy.
